Beyond the translation

Overall song meaning

This song from the film 'Thanippiravi' (1966) captures the joyous and romantic revelations of a young woman describing her unexpected love to her close female companion ('adi'). She recounts the magical moment her lover entered her life, describing how his image became permanently etched in her sight, bringing an ever-growing bliss that leaves her feeling weightless and captivated.

Writing craft

Poetic devices

Iyaipu (End Rhyme)

Edhirpaaraamal nadandhadhadi… / Mugam kannukkul vizhundhadhadi… / Puthiya sugham ondru pugundhadhadi…

The repetition of the ending suffix '-adhadi' creates a rhythmic, conversational end-rhyme scheme throughout the verses.

Simile (Upamai Ani)

Ennai malligai poo pol / Alli kondaan

The heroine compares herself to a soft jasmine flower ('malligai poo pol') gently gathered up by her beloved.

Mythological Allusion / Metaphor

Vadivael murugan ena vandhaan / Kuravalli endrae naan edhir konden

The lyricist compares the hero to Lord Murugan with his spear and the heroine to his consort Valli, elevating romantic love to a divine plane.

Ethugai (Second Letter Rhyme)

Panjanai mayakkam paravudhadi / Anjana vizhigal thudikkudhadi

The second consonant sound 'n-ja' in 'Panjanai' and 'Anjana' creates a pleasing Tamil poetic harmony.

Did you know?

Trivia

'Thanippiravi' (1966) is a classic Tamil action-drama film starring M. G. Ramachandran (MGR) and J. Jayalalithaa. The music was composed by K. V. Mahadevan, and the iconic track 'Edhirpaaraamal nadandhadhadi' was sung by the legendary playback singer P. Susheela. Poet Kannadasan masterfully woven divine Murugan bhakti imagery into romantic lyrics, reflecting Tamil cultural traditions where love is celebrated through devotional allegories.
